Refractive index (n) of a medium is given by
[tex]n=\frac{c}{v};[/tex]Here n= refractive index;
c= speed of light in vaccum
v= speed of light in medium.
According to problem
[tex]\begin{gathered} n=\frac{c}{v}\begin{cases}c={3\times10^8}\frac{m}{s} \\ n={1.50}\end{cases} \\ \\ \therefore\text{ 1.50=}\frac{3\times10^8}{v} \\ \therefore v\text{ = }\frac{3\times10^8}{1.50}=\text{ 2}\times10^8m\text{ /s;} \end{gathered}[/tex]Final answer is
